1. What is the 3/4 Crushed Stone Calculator?

The 3/4 Crushed Stone Calculator estimates the tonnage of crushed stone needed for a project based on area dimensions and desired depth. It's commonly used for landscaping, construction, and road base projects.

2. How Does the Calculator Work?

The calculator uses the following formula:

\[ \text{Tons} = \left( \frac{\text{Length} \times \text{Width} \times (\text{Depth}/12)}{27} \right) \times \text{Density} \]

Where:

Explanation: The formula converts all measurements to consistent units, calculates volume in cubic yards, then multiplies by material density to get weight in tons.

3. Importance of Accurate Calculation

Details: Proper calculation ensures you order the right amount of material - too little delays your project, while too much wastes money on excess material and disposal.

4. Using the Calculator

Tips: Measure your project area carefully. For irregular shapes, divide into rectangles. Typical depth for walkways is 4", driveways 8-12". Density varies by stone type and compaction.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: What's the typical density for 3/4" crushed stone?
A: Most 3/4" crushed stone has a density between 1.4-1.7 tons per cubic yard, depending on stone type and compaction.

Q2: How do I measure an irregular area?
A: Divide into rectangular sections, calculate each separately, then sum the totals.

Q3: Should I order extra material?
A: It's recommended to order 10-15% extra to account for compaction, uneven surfaces, and calculation variances.

Q4: What's the difference between crushed stone and gravel?
A: Crushed stone is angular and mechanically crushed, while gravel is rounded and naturally formed. Crushed stone typically compacts better.

Q5: How deep should I lay 3/4" crushed stone?
A: For walkways: 4", driveways: 8-12", patio bases: 4-6". Depth depends on load requirements and subgrade conditions.
